位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el单元 > 文章详情

Excel隐藏单元格自动序号

作者:excel百科网
|
400人看过
发布时间:2026-01-15 02:46:39
标签:
Excel隐藏单元格自动序号:实用技巧与深度解析在Excel中,隐藏单元格是一种常见操作,用于保护数据或提升界面整洁度。然而,有时候用户希望在不显示数据的情况下,自动为单元格添加序号,以方便追踪或统计。本文将详细讲解如何在Excel中
Excel隐藏单元格自动序号
Excel隐藏单元格自动序号:实用技巧与深度解析
在Excel中,隐藏单元格是一种常见操作,用于保护数据或提升界面整洁度。然而,有时候用户希望在不显示数据的情况下,自动为单元格添加序号,以方便追踪或统计。本文将详细讲解如何在Excel中实现“隐藏单元格自动序号”的功能,并结合实际应用场景进行深入解析。
一、隐藏单元格的定义与用途
隐藏单元格是指在Excel中将某一单元格或一组单元格设置为不可见,但数据仍然保留。这种操作常用于保护数据、避免误操作或提高界面美观度。隐藏单元格可以通过“开始”选项卡中的“隐藏和突出显示”功能来实现。
在实际应用中,隐藏单元格可以用于以下场景:
- 隐藏不必要的数据列
- 隐藏表头或标题行
- 隐藏不需要显示的计算结果
- 保护敏感数据
然而,隐藏单元格并非完全不可见,数据仍然存在,只是不可见。因此,如果需要在隐藏单元格中添加序号,需在不显示数据的前提下,仍然能够记录序号信息。
二、隐藏单元格自动序号的实现方法
1. 使用公式生成序号
在Excel中,可以使用`ROW()`函数或`ROW() + 1`来生成自动序号。例如:
- `=ROW()`:返回当前行号
- `=ROW() + 1`:返回当前行号加1
这些公式可以用于生成序号,但需要将这些公式放在隐藏单元格中,以确保其不显示。具体操作如下:
1. 在目标单元格输入公式,如`=ROW()`
2. 右键点击单元格,选择“设置单元格格式”
3. 在“数字”选项卡中,选择“数值”并设置小数位数为0
4. 选择“隐藏”选项,使单元格不可见
这样,隐藏单元格中就会显示序号,但数据不会被显示出来。
2. 使用VBA宏实现自动序号
对于需要频繁使用序号的场景,可以使用VBA宏来实现隐藏单元格自动序号的功能。VBA宏可以自动为隐藏单元格生成序号,并在每次点击时更新。
步骤如下:
1. 按`Alt + F11`打开VBA编辑器
2. 在左侧项目窗口中找到你的工作表,右键点击,选择“插入”→“模块”
3. 在模块中输入以下代码:
vba
Sub AddAutoNumber()
Dim rng As Range
Dim i As Integer
Set rng = Range("A1:A10") ' 设置需要隐藏的单元格范围
i = 1
For Each cell In rng
If cell.EntireRow.Hidden Then
cell.Value = i
i = i + 1
End If
Next cell
End Sub

4. 按`F5`运行宏,即可为隐藏单元格添加序号。
这种方法非常适合需要自动化处理的场景,能够高效地为隐藏单元格添加序号。
三、隐藏单元格自动序号的应用场景
1. 数据统计与记录
在数据统计中,隐藏单元格可以用于记录数据的来源或统计信息。例如,可以隐藏某一行数据,同时在该行中添加序号,方便后续统计或分析。
2. 表格美化
隐藏单元格可以用于美化表格,使界面更加整洁。例如,可以隐藏不必要的列,同时在隐藏列中添加序号,以表示该列的编号。
3. 数据保护
在敏感数据的处理中,隐藏单元格可以用于保护数据,确保数据不被误操作。同时,通过在隐藏单元格中添加序号,可以方便地追踪数据的修改记录。
四、隐藏单元格自动序号的注意事项
1. 序号的更新
在使用VBA宏或公式生成序号时,需要确保在每次更新数据时,序号也能同步更新。否则,序号会停留在旧值,影响数据的准确性。
2. 隐藏单元格的范围
需要明确隐藏单元格的范围,避免序号生成错误。可以设置一个特定的区域,如A1:A10,确保序号只在该区域内生成。
3. 公式与VBA的兼容性
在使用公式生成序号时,需要确保公式在隐藏单元格中仍然有效。可以通过设置“数值”格式,并在“隐藏”选项中启用“显示公式”,以确保公式仍然可见,但数据不可见。
五、隐藏单元格自动序号的进阶技巧
1. 使用条件格式设置序号
在Excel中,可以使用条件格式来设置隐藏单元格的序号。例如,可以将隐藏单元格设置为某种颜色,同时在单元格中显示序号,以增强可读性。
2. 使用公式动态生成序号
可以使用动态公式生成序号,例如:
- `=ROW() + 1`:生成当前行号加1的序号
- `=ROW() - 1`:生成当前行号减1的序号
这些公式可以根据需要灵活调整,适用于不同的隐藏单元格范围。
3. 使用Excel表格功能
Excel表格功能可以自动识别隐藏单元格,并在表格中显示序号。这种方法适用于表格数据的处理,能够提高效率。
六、隐藏单元格自动序号的未来趋势
随着Excel功能的不断更新,隐藏单元格自动序号的功能也逐渐向更智能化、自动化的方向发展。未来,Excel可能会引入更多自动化功能,例如:
- 自动识别隐藏单元格的范围
- 动态调整序号
- 更灵活的序号生成方式
这些功能将进一步提升Excel在数据处理和管理中的效率。
七、总结
在Excel中实现隐藏单元格自动序号的功能,既能够保护数据,又能提升数据的可管理性。无论是通过公式、VBA宏,还是条件格式,都可以实现这一目标。在实际应用中,需根据具体需求选择合适的方法,并注意序号的更新、隐藏范围的设置以及公式与VBA的兼容性。
通过合理使用隐藏单元格自动序号功能,用户可以在保护数据的同时,提升工作效率,实现数据管理的精细化和智能化。
八、
在Excel中,隐藏单元格自动序号是一项实用且高效的技巧。无论是用于数据统计、表格美化,还是数据保护,都能带来显著的好处。通过本文的讲解,用户可以掌握这一技能,并根据实际需求灵活应用。希望本文对读者在Excel使用中有所帮助,也欢迎读者在评论区分享自己的使用经验。
推荐文章
相关文章
推荐URL
Excel自动变换单元格颜色:实用技巧与深度解析Excel作为一款广泛使用的电子表格软件,其强大的功能和灵活性使得用户在日常工作中能够高效地处理数据。其中,单元格颜色自动变换是一项非常实用的功能,它不仅能够提升数据的可读性,还
2026-01-15 02:46:36
286人看过
Excel单元格如何行列互换:深度实用指南在Excel中,数据的组织与管理是日常工作的重要环节。而单元格的行列互换,是数据处理中非常常用的一个技巧,尤其在数据整理、表格重组、数据迁移等场景中,能够显著提升工作效率。本文将从多个角度,系
2026-01-15 02:45:27
247人看过
手机Excel单元格内换行的实用技巧与深度解析在日常办公和数据分析中,Excel作为一款强大的电子表格工具,常常被用来处理大量的数据和复杂的计算。然而,对于许多用户来说,Excel的使用往往停留在基础操作层面。其中,单元格内换行是一项
2026-01-15 02:44:59
194人看过
Excel 单元格批量删除回车的实用技巧与深度解析在Excel中,单元格数据的处理是日常工作中的常事。当我们复制数据、填充公式或导入外部数据时,往往会遇到一些格式上的问题,例如单元格中出现多余的“回车”字符。这些字符不仅影响数据的准确
2026-01-15 02:44:47
254人看过
热门推荐
热门专题:
资讯中心: